Organization of crane services for loading oversized cargo onto trucks and unloading operations at the port yarded, livering shipments alongside the vessel as well as customs clearance – this was the scope of Rohlig SUUS Logistics’ role in transporting large and heavy components of a gas separation installation.

The task involved the transport of several oversized units to the storage yard at the Port of Gdańsk, their delivery to the ship, and full customs handling. The dimensions of the cargo posed a particular challenge – the highest unit reached nearly 6.4 meters, while the heaviest weighed 29 tons. For this reason, a tailor-made project cargo solution was designed and executed to ensure the safe and timely flow of operations.

Specialized unloading and loading operations

The size and weight of the cargo required the use of specialized cranes for all handling operations – for loading the units onto trucks, unloading them at the port storage yard, and finally positioning them under the vessel’s hook using dedicated road equipment, in accordance with FAS (Free Alongside Ship) Incoterms.

The key to success was precise coordination between all involved parties – crane operators, carriers, and port teams – ensuring that each stage of the operation was completed efficiently and safely.

Comprehensive customs handling

As part of the project, comprehensive customs services were also provided by Rohlig SUUS Logistic, supporting the efficient export of goods and ensuring full compliance with port procedures

 

Package 001 : L: 21,60 x W: 2,855 x H: 4,71 (meter) // Gross weight : 29 000 KGS

Package 002 : L: 8,60 x W: 4,06 x H: 1,35 (meter) // Gross weight : 3 975 KGS

Package 003 : L: 8,31 x W: 4,33 x H: 6,37 (meter) // Gross weight : 27 100 KGS
